Haydamaky to headl<strong>in</strong>e<br />

Soyuzivka’s Ukra<strong>in</strong>ian festival<br />

by Matthew Dubas<br />

PARSIPPANY, N.J. – Soyuzivka will<br />

be host<strong>in</strong>g its fourth annual Ukra<strong>in</strong>ian<br />

Cultural Festival on July 16-18, under the<br />

patronage <strong>of</strong> the Embassy <strong>of</strong> Ukra<strong>in</strong>e.<br />

New for this year will be a beer garden,<br />

featur<strong>in</strong>g cont<strong>in</strong>uous live music, with Hrim<br />

<strong>of</strong> New York, Zrada <strong>of</strong> W<strong>in</strong>nipeg, and many<br />

more bands. “Zabavy” (dances) <strong>in</strong> the even<strong>in</strong>g<br />

will be the place for a kolomiyka<br />

showdown between the Roma Pryma<br />

Bohachevsky Dance Workshop and Kupalo<br />

Ukra<strong>in</strong>ian Dance Ensemble <strong>of</strong> Edmonton.<br />

Vendors will be on hand to sell various<br />

Ukra<strong>in</strong>ian items, from embroidered shirts<br />

to pa<strong>in</strong>t<strong>in</strong>gs. A food pavilion will be set<br />

up to <strong>of</strong>fer Ukra<strong>in</strong>ian delicacies to the<br />

many visitors who travel great distances<br />

to attend this major U.S. event for the<br />

Ukra<strong>in</strong>ian community.<br />

The performance schedule <strong>in</strong>cludes the<br />

Canadian Bandurist Capella <strong>of</strong> Toronto<br />

and the Dumka Chorus <strong>of</strong> New York. The<br />

featured performers are the Haydamaky, a<br />

Kozak-style rock band, that plays a bit <strong>of</strong><br />

rock, dub, punk and ska, <strong>in</strong> their own<br />

concert at 9 p.m. on Saturday, July 17.<br />

L e d b y O l e k s a n d r Ya r m o l a ,<br />

Haydamamky’s 2010 tour has <strong>in</strong>cluded<br />

performances <strong>in</strong> Poland, Ukra<strong>in</strong>e and<br />

Estonia. On April 26 they performed <strong>in</strong><br />

Switzerland <strong>in</strong> memory <strong>of</strong> the Chornobyl<br />

disaster. The band was awarded “Wirtualne<br />

Gesle” by Poland for its collaboration with<br />

Polish legend Voo Voo, for best album for<br />

2009, “Voo Voo i Haydamaky.” This was<br />

the band’s sixth album release. For more<br />

<strong>in</strong>formation on Haydamky, visit their website<br />

www.haydamaky.com.<br />
